
Rohde & Schwarz and Airways achieve key milestone on path to modernize New Zealand's air traffic management infrastructure Site acceptance testing for delivering communications systems to the Auckland and Christchurch ATC centers, has been successfully completed. This paves the way for Rohde & Schwarz Australia to deliver further upgrades to the New Zealand ATC system as part of subsequent stage work.

Airways and New Zealand are now one step closer to enjoying the benefits of a modern air traffic control (ATC) communications system, thanks to the superb collaboration of both Rohde & Schwarz and Airways teams in delivering the first stage of the New Zealand Internet Protocol Voice Communication System (IP VCS) project.

CERTIUM VCS-4G IP-based communications technology will significantly increase resilience of the network as Airways moves towards a new one centre, two location operational model across its Auckland and Christchurch locations.
With its quad-redundant and distributed architecture, CERTIUM VCS-4G will revolutionise Airway's flexibility to manage their operations in a single trusted environment, Mr. Evans said.
Demanding a tailored solution of approximately 1000 requirements - almost 200 needing software development - our integration scope comprises an interface to the new ATM system, new ATC radios, new ATC voice recorders, a nationwide enterprise network, and various ground-ground communication lines.
Following stages of the IP voice communications system (VCS) project will see Rohde & Schwarz and Airways continue to work together to deliver Contingency Centers in both Auckland and Christchurch, as well as rolling out new systems to the 22 towers located across the New Zealand ATC network. The site acceptance testing milestone also marks the commencement of the IP VCS Support Contract, which will see Rohde & Schwarz Australia provide sustainment and maintenance services over the next 15 years.

Rohde & Schwarz has successfully delivered communications systems to over 200 airports and area control centres all over the world. The Airways IP VCS contract was signed on June 21, 2018 and the overall project includes the delivery, implementation and through-life support for over 200 controller working positions. The project is being managed, delivered and supported by Rohde & Schwarz Australia, leveraging the extensive CERTIUM VCS-4G product expertise of Rohde & Schwarz. CERTIUM VCS is the most widely deployed full IP VCS on the market.
Airways Corporation is the sole Air Traffic Service provider in New Zealand, operating two radar centres and 22 control towers across the country. Airways controls all domestic and international air traffic travelling within New Zealand's Flight Information Region, which totals 30 million square kilometres - one of the largest areas of airspace in the world.
